New World Bank Framework Aims to Reduce Harm from Development Initiatives

The World Bank has unveiled a new framework designed to significantly reduce the negative social and environmental impacts of its development projects. This groundbreaking initiative, years in the making, aims to shift the paradigm from simply mitigating harm to proactively preventing it, ensuring a more sustainable and equitable future for communities worldwide. The framework represents a crucial step towards aligning development goals with environmental and social safeguards, addressing long-standing criticisms of large-scale development projects.

A Paradigm Shift in Development Practices

For decades, the World Bank and similar institutions have faced criticism for development projects that, while intending to improve lives, inadvertently caused displacement, environmental degradation, and social disruption. This new framework directly tackles these concerns. Instead of a reactive approach focused on damage control after a project's implementation, the new system emphasizes proactive risk assessment and mitigation before a project even begins.

Key Components of the New Framework:

The framework incorporates several key components designed to ensure greater accountability and transparency:

  • Strengthened Environmental and Social Safeguards: The updated safeguards are more stringent, encompassing a wider range of environmental and social risks, including climate change impacts, biodiversity loss, and indigenous rights. This includes rigorous environmental impact assessments and robust community consultations.

  • Increased Stakeholder Engagement: The framework places a strong emphasis on early and meaningful engagement with affected communities, ensuring their voices are heard and their concerns addressed throughout the project lifecycle. This includes increased transparency and accessibility of information.

  • Enhanced Monitoring and Evaluation: A robust monitoring and evaluation system will track the social and environmental performance of projects, allowing for timely adjustments and ensuring accountability for negative impacts. Independent oversight mechanisms will also play a critical role.

  • Focus on Prevention, Not Just Mitigation: A core principle of the framework is the prioritization of preventing harm in the first place. This involves a more thorough risk assessment process and the integration of environmental and social considerations into the project design from the outset.

  • Capacity Building and Knowledge Sharing: The World Bank is committed to building the capacity of its staff and partner organizations to effectively implement the new framework, promoting knowledge sharing and best practices across its operations.

Addressing Criticisms and Building Trust

This new framework represents a direct response to years of criticism regarding the World Bank's development projects. By prioritizing prevention, increasing transparency, and strengthening stakeholder engagement, the institution aims to rebuild trust with communities and demonstrate a genuine commitment to sustainable and equitable development. The success of this framework will be measured not only by its impact on the environment and social justice, but also by the increased trust and collaboration it fosters with local populations.

Looking Ahead: Challenges and Opportunities

While the new framework offers significant potential for positive change, challenges remain. Effective implementation requires strong political will, sufficient resources, and a commitment to holding institutions accountable. However, the framework also presents significant opportunities to advance sustainable development practices globally, setting a new standard for responsible development finance. The coming years will be crucial in assessing the framework's effectiveness and its long-term impact on communities worldwide. The World Bank's commitment to transparency and collaboration will be key to its success.
